If your Talking Points app is not working, it may be because you do not have an Infinite Campus Parent Portal account. Talking Points is linked directly to the Parent Portal, so without one, the system cannot connect.
To set up your Parent Portal, we must be able to provide you with a username and password, therefore please contact our office on Monday-Friday from 8:40am-2:00pm and we will help get you set up. Thank you!

United Way of Southern Kentucky’s (UWSK) 2-1-1 program is a great resource for those who need a little extra help. No matter the needs such as housing/shelter, food, utilities assistance, support groups, employee assistance and more, UWSK’s 2-1-1 team is available to help connect area residents with available community resources. Upon receiving calls from community members, the 2-1-1 team accesses various databases of resources and connects the callers to the appropriate agencies to receive assistance. To access the line, simply dial 2-1-1.

Staying healthy is an important part of education. If your child doesn’t have health insurance, you may qualify for KCHIP, Kentucky Children’s Health Insurance Program. It provides comprehensive coverage at no cost. There are many students across the district who qualify but are not signed up. To find out more, go to kidshealth.ky.gov or call (877) 524-4718 – because every child needs health insurance.
